Celia Hardy 05 Aug 2010

Lifestyle

Roses Galore Ltd and Plants Galore Ltd. Celia Hardy, born and educated in Kenya, commenced a career in horticulture in 1990 working with various nurseries and landscape companies. In 1999 she opened her own landscape company, Roses Galore Ltd, which now employs 70 staff and has completed many projects both large and small, for industries, hotels and lodges, government institutions and private residences. In 2008 a second company was formed, Plants Galore Ltd, to cater for the growing demand for quality plants of more unusual varieties and species, retailing through a high class garden centre. For this venture an undeveloped plot was purchased in the Kigwaru Estate, adjacent to Runda, and landscaped to suit the display of plants and pots for sale, with an adjacent shop for selling many other gardening items. Both these companies continue to grow and are both rated as one of the best in the country.
